针对海冰密度排液法测试中需要一种冰点低且粘度合适的液体,发现蜂蜜-盐水溶液以其不冻结、粘度高、易储存等特点成为最具潜力的理想“标靶”液体.通过配制不同蜂蜜与盐水体积百分比浓度的溶液,测试这些蜂蜜-盐水溶液在不同温度下的粘度.利用正交试验测试数据,结合文献报道的理论及数学表达式,统计分析了溶液粘度分别同温度、浓度的特征;最后建立了描述蜂蜜-盐水溶液粘度同温度和浓度之间的综合统计关系.能够用来计算在特定温度范围内,所要求理想粘度对应的蜂蜜-盐水溶液的体积百分比.由此配制的蜂蜜-盐水溶液可以成为排液法准确测量不规则海冰样品密度的核心技术支撑.
